Papers inside, lol. Back in the day, they would place wallpaper sheets, inside of cabinets and drawers of dressers. They didn't paste them in so that they could remove them, without damage. The purpose of the wallpaper was to keep splinters off of clothing, and to keep out bugs. Expensive ones where sold with smells to keep out bugs. However wallpaper was costly at the time. So people would buy leftover, or discount wallpaper books and rip out the pages. That is why they often don't match. Cheaper wallpaper was thiner, and looks like regular paper to us now. I always like to learn new things, and I hope this helps you to understand for the future, also may help if you ever have to remove, stuck on ones. As our new removers don't work, but wallpaper remover dose. As always thank you for your hard work and time, and sharing your passion with us.

I used to remove wallpaper for a living before painting walls. The easiest way to remove old wallpaper is to mist it with warm water - let it sit (not dry) & scrape it off with a paint scraper. The water helps moisten the old glue so that it releases.
